Risk Priority Number (RPN) is a numeric assessment of a risk to help identify critical failure modes in a process or a design. It ranges from 1 to 1000. It is calculated while doing Failure Modes and Effect Analysis using the below formula
RPN = Severity (S) x Occurrence (O) x Detection (D)
